Images from Teton, Yellowstone, and Crater Lake National Parks. Crater Lake was a Aug. trip which was very warm with thunder showers most afternoons so if you plan a photo trip there you might want to keep that in mind. Great lakes for sea kayaking in both Teton and Yellowstone which was a fall trip around mid to late Sept. Nice as neither park was overly crowded although some nights and early mornings where below freezing in temp. Great sunrise and sunset shooting in both parks with loads of wildlife as well. Got to watch Elk start that annual rut process and actually had a satellite bull bugling in my face 10 feet away at camp in Mammoth Hot Springs. Exciting!
